Clunk 03-17-2008 07:36 PM

Those lines take a while to prime after being empty. With the throttle floored, crank for 10 seconds, wait a minute then crank another 10 seconds until fuel shows up at the injector fittings then tighten them up and start the truck. I loosened #1,#3,#4 & #5 until fuel arrived.
If it ran fine before, it'll run fine now...keep the batteries charged.
